Play festival continues with ‘Permanent Ink’

-

The Warner Theatre’s next production of the 9th Annual Internatio­nal Playwright­s Festival is “Permanent Ink” by Charlene Donaghy.

Performanc­es filmed from the Warner’s Nancy Marine Studio Theatre begin Jan. 29.

“Permanent Ink” is the companion piece of “Always A Line,” which was produced during the 8th Annual Internatio­nal Playwright­s Festival. As a bonus, the Warner is including that production after this year’s performanc­e in the same stream presentati­on.

In response to the pandemic, the Internatio­nal Playwright­s Festival is a virtual event,with each production recorded in the Warner’s Nancy Marine Studio Theatre over a period of several weeks and then shown on YouTube and Facebook every other Friday until April.

The mission of the Internatio­nal Playwright­s Festival is to recognize the work of emerging and establishe­d playwright­s and to build a link between the playwright­s, the theatre community and our audiences. The festival is a celebratio­n of new works by playwright­s from across the country and around the globe. For the ninth year, 150 plays were accepted for considerat­ion from across the United States and as far away as China and New Zealand.

Each production will be available to view online for a period of two weeks before being taken down. There is no fee to watch but donations are always accepted. This virtual festival is made possible with a generous donation from The Marine Family.

Streaming for “Permanent Ink” begins at 7 p.m Jan. 29, and be available online until Feb. 11 at 11:59 p.m. The production is directed by Sharon W. Houk and features Josh Newey and Jeff Savage. Original music is by James Luurtsema.

The story: The night before Dick’s wedding, his

Captain Morgan-loving best man lets lose a secret about the bride-to-be, Rae, and her childhood friend, propelling a drunken Dick to confront her. With the comedic help of the mysteries of life from the ancient, cagey Fester, Dick must ponder whether love, permanentl­y inked within in the very tissue of your life, is more real than plastered fear.

Donaghy is an awardwinni­ng playwright with plays produced and/or awarded from New York City to Los Angeles, in Canada and Great Britain. Hansen Publishing Group publishes Charlene's Bones of Home and Other Plays. Charlene has been honored with numerous other publicatio­ns. Charlene is Producer/Tennessee Williams Theater Festival, Festival

Director/Warner Internatio­nal Playwright­s Festival and teaches playwritin­g and theatre at University of Nebraska Omaha. She is a founding member Proscenium Playwright­s, and a member of 9th Floor Playwright­s, The Playwright­s Center, and The Dramatists Guild. www.charlenead­onaghy.com
